While I did the utterly enthralling topic of housing quality in Portsmouth for my Geography A-Level coursework, my brother has decided to deviate from the list provided by his sixth form and complete his coursework on the proposed community stadium at Falmer.

To contribute to his coursework he has devised a questionnaire for fans of the Albion and Falmer residents. He has asked me to put the questionnaire on here, and I know he will greatly appreciate it if anyone can spare a couple of minutes to complete his questionnaire.

Why do you believe the benefits of the stadium out-weigh the impact on the local landscape? aside from the fact that it's the only site for a stadium that the club NEEDS to survive; the impact on the landscape will be negligible due to the fact that the proposed site is a dump and the stadium will be largely hidden by the contours of the land. Also, an undertaking such as the construction and running of the stadium will create many jobs in the area (also not forgetting the train station upgrades and university buildings), helping to regenerate the economy of east brighton - something the council want to do. It will also bring consdierable benefits to the community such as providing activities and education for children, which is likely to result in; amongst other things a fall in crime in the area
